Vue d'Amboine, Prise des hauteurs de Batou-Ganton. (Moluques.)
de Sainson pinx.t. Nousveau Lith.
J. Tastu Editeur. Lith. de Bichebois aîné, rue déry, 23. [Paris, n.d. c.1833.]
Lithograph. 342 x 508mm. 13¼ x 20". Paper toning around the edges. Some spotting.
A French explorer in the foreground with a servant holding a parasol to shade his master from the sun; in the background the Island of Ambon, Indonesia, with ships and smaller vessels in the bay. Numbered 'Pl.146' upper right; from 'Voyage de la Corvette l'Astrolabe', the account of Jules Dumont D'Urville's important expedition to the South Seas between 1826 and 1829. Publisher's blindstamp below title. After Louis Auguste de Sainson (1801 - 1887).
See NLA: 2713024. Ex Norman Blackburn Collection.
